Settlements

In the majority of medical malpractice lawsuits the plaintiff and defendant agree to an agreement prior to the case is even tried. This lets both parties avoid costly and stressful court costs, and provides the plaintiff with a guarantee of a fair settlement. In the event that the trial is not able to be concluded, a jury will determine if the defendants owe the plaintiff any compensation and the amount of they must pay.

The first step towards receiving the financial compensation you deserve for your child's birth injury law firms injury is to prove that the doctor you hired to deliver your baby had a professional relationship with you, and he violated this obligation during the birthing procedure. You can prove this using medical documents and birth injury law firm hospital invoices. Your lawyer will also need to collect evidence that proves the breach caused the injuries to your child.

If you have evidence, your lawyer will then submit a list of demands to the malpractice insurance companies of the defendants. This document contains a thorough letter that outlines the child's injuries and the supporting documents. The malpractice insurance company will look over the demand, and decide whether to accept or deny it. If the demand is rejected, your lawyer will make a claim.

If you are the victim of a successful birth injury lawsuit your lawyer may suggest placing the proceeds of your settlement or award into a special trust for children with disabilities. This will permit you to make future payments to your child for things like medicine, physical therapy, and home modifications.

Statute of limitations

Medical professionals have their own set of rules they must adhere to during procedures. This includes the statute of limitations, which sets a deadline for filing lawsuits. This limitation is designed to ensure that claims are filed when evidence is available in physical form and witnesses' memories are fresh. Even if a lawsuit has an established legal foundation it will be dismissed if it's filed after the statute of limitations has expired.

The statute of limitations can be important for birth injuries. A successful lawsuit can offer compensation for the victim's current and future medical expenses or lost wages as a result of being away from work to take care of their child, as well as emotional stress. In certain cases, a jury or judge will also award punitive damages intended to penalize defendants who have committed a grave inattention to detail.

Expert Witnesses

In the event of a medical malpractice case expert witnesses can assist jurors and judges comprehend the evidence and the facts of the case. They can also provide expert opinions or inferences to assist them in making an informed decision. They are able to do so because their expertise is more reputable and detailed than that of a layperson, or someone with no medical training.

Legal representatives can hire an expert witness to review medical records, give an account and assist the lawyer to put together the case. The expert would then sign an affidavit as well as testify in court about their findings. An expert can be an employee of a hospital or health care provider at the institution of the defendant or an outsider.

The expert's testimony should reflect the current state of medical knowledge in the case at the time. Experts should not criticize or condone performance within the generally accepted standards of practice. Experts should be prepared to provide deposition transcripts as well as courtroom testimony to be reviewed by a peer. They should not enter into contracts where the fees for their expert testimony are inordinately high relative to their time and effort involved.
